The Bitcoin Revolution: Historical Context

Bitcoin, the world's first decentralized digital currency, emerged in 2009 in the wake of the global financial crisis. Created by an unknown person or group of people using the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to, Bitcoin introduced the concept of blockchain technology—a transparent, secure, and immutable ledger system.



Why Bitcoin Matters

Bitcoin represents more than just a new form of money; it embodies a paradigm shift in how we perceive and handle transactions. Its decentralized nature removes the need for intermediaries, such as banks, reducing transaction fees and enhancing security. This democratization of finance is empowering individuals across the globe, especially in regions with unstable financial systems.

Diversification and Risk Management

Bitcoin offers a new avenue for portfolio diversification. While it remains a volatile asset, its low correlation with traditional markets can provide a hedge against economic downturns. Young investors, who typically have a higher risk tolerance, can benefit from allocating a portion of their portfolio to Bitcoin, balancing it with more traditional investments.



Practical Tips for Navigating the World of Digital Currencies: Do Your Research

The first step in investing in Bitcoin is education. Young investors should take the time to understand how Bitcoin and blockchain technology work. Numerous online resources, including courses, webinars, and forums, can provide valuable information.


Start Small

Given its volatility, it's prudent to start with a small investment. This approach allows investors to familiarize themselves with the market dynamics without exposing themselves to significant risk.


Use Reputable Platforms

When buying Bitcoin, it's essential to use reputable exchanges and wallets. Security should be a top priority, so choose platforms that offer robust security measures, such as two-factor authentication and cold storage options.


Stay Informed

The cryptocurrency market is fast-paced and constantly evolving. Staying informed about regulatory changes, market trends, and technological advancements is crucial for making informed investment decisions.
